Jeffrey D. Kottkamp (born November 12, 1960) is an American politician and lawyer. He was 17th Lieutenant Governor of Florida from 2007 until 2011. He is a member of the Republican Party. Kottkamp was a member of the Florida House of Representatives from 2000 to 2006. He unsuccessfully ran for Florida Attorney General in 2010.
